Smart keys

BMW smart keys make it simple to unlock and start a car. These keys contain a chip with an encrypted code that your vehicle can recognize. An antenna mounted on the door handle of the car reads these codes, and tells the vehicle's computer whether the key is compatible with the car. This ensures that no one else will be able to unlock or start the engine without your BMW. Smart keys are also more secure than traditional key fobs, as they utilize rolling codes to verify their authenticity.

A BMW smart key can be shared with up to five iPhones and Apple Watches. You can also make use of the app to deny access to other users. To accomplish this you'll require an iPhone with Live Cockpit as well as the most current version of the My BMW app. Tesla and Lincoln also have similar technology for phones as key.

The latest BMW models have digital keys that communicate with the car using a Near Field Communication (NFC) chip, which is built into the car. This tech can be used with Samsung and Android smartphones however, you'll require a key to lock and start the vehicle. It's not a substitute for the traditional key fob, however, it is a great alternative if you don't wish to carry around a second mobile device.

Keys that have a built-in transponder

BMW is renowned for its sleek design and advanced technology, but even the most reliable cars may have issues occasionally. In these situations, you can trust a locksmith to handle the task. Professionals have the necessary training and experience to synchronize electronic components within a key fob. They can cut new keys for your BMW as well as replace the battery in its remote control unit (RCU).

Some BMW owners may be tempted to buy replacement keys from an online vendor. Be aware that these keys might not be compatible with your BMW model and could not work properly. Some online sellers do not offer warranties or return policies.

The BMW key comes with a transponder. It's embedded microchip inside the plastic head. This chip communicates to the engine's computer in order to begin your vehicle. The transponder is notified of a unique response. If the response is not correct, the engine will not begin. This feature is designed to stop the theft of the vehicle.

These keys are also referred to as proximity keys or smart keys. They can be used to lock and unlock your car without using the physical key, and can also operate your windows and mirrors. While they're costly they provide a higher level security than regular keys.

Transponder keys are more secure and less likely to be stolen than regular keys. They are also easier to program. However, they may be difficult to repair or replace when you've lost them. You can find a suitable replacement online, if you know what you're searching for.

Some people can find bmw 3 series key fob replacement key fobs on eBay, but beware. These keys aren't compatible with the BMW system and will not work with the vehicle. To use these keys, you need to go to the dealership with a photo ID and your registration. The dealership will then order the BMW key and register it with your vehicle. In this way the key isn't registered to anyone else and can't be duplicated.

Cost

BMW owners usually take pride in their vehicles, and it is no surprise that they'd like to keep them in good condition. But when a key fob gets lost, it can be an expensive fix. There are many options to obtain a replacement key. You can visit a posh locksmith or dealership to get a blank cut for you. But if you're on the run, you can also find an online seller who is specialized in keys for BMWs. Be sure to look over the reviews and customer feedback prior to purchasing.

A key programming service is another option. These services cost a small amount to sync your keys to the car's system. They also provide a warranty on their work. It's important to note that authentic BMW key fob comes with unique features that cannot be duplicated by third-party companies. These features include an individual driver profile that records the settings of each driver. These features make it harder for hackers to hack or otherwise compromising a BMW security system.

The cost of the BMW replacement key fob will depend on the year and model of the vehicle, and whether it includes additional features such as remote control or proximity technology. The average price of a brand new bmw key programmer key ranges from $200 to $500. This price includes the cost of the key and the cost of programming it to the car's system.

In some cases dealers will charge a flat price for the replacement of a key fob. This is a great option when you're in rush or have a limited budget. However, it's important to remember that these prices are not guaranteed and can be subject to change without notice.

You can also cut down on time if you're in a hurry by replacing the battery in your BMW key fob. They are generally sold as watch batteries and are available in a variety of sizes. Be cautious when removing the backplate of the fob, since this can cause damage to the electronic components.
